About Device
Settings
About Device
View information about your device,
including status, legal information,
hardware and software versions, and
more.
1. From a Home screen, tap Apps > Settings.
2. Tap About device, and then tap items for more
details:
•
Download updates manually: Check for and
install available software updates.
•
Download updates automatically: Check for
and download updates automatically when the
device is connected to a Wi-Fi network.
•
Scheduled software updates: Set a time to
automatically check for and install available
software updates.
•
Icon glossary: View information about the
status icons and notification icons used on the
Status bar.
•
Status: View the status of the battery, network,
and other information.
•
Legal information: View legal notices
and other legal information, including your
embedded Samsung legal information.
•
Device name: View and change your device’s
name.
•
Additional device information includes the
Model number, Android version, Build number,
and more.
